Error 0x80004005: How to fix it for good

This error may occur if a file that the Windows Product Activation (WPA) requires is damaged or missing. This behavior occurs if one or both of the following conditions are true: A third-party backup utility or an antivirus program interferes with the installation of Windows XP.

You can fix the error 0x80004005 for good by following the given solutions:

Fix 1: Run a System File Checker Scan

The error 0x80004005 might be due to a corrupted system file. As such, the system File Checker, which repairs corrupted system files, might resolve the error.

You can utilize SFC in Windows as follows:

  • Open the Command Prompt as an administrator b pressing the Windows key + X hotkey and selecting Command Prompt (Admin).
  • First, input DISM.exe/Online/Cleanup-image/Restorehealth To run the Deployment Image Servicing and Management tool in Windows.
  • Then run the SFC scan by entering sfc/scan now in the Prompt and pressing Return.
  • The SFC scan and might take about 20-30 minutes to complete. Restart your desktop or laptop if the scan does repair a file.

Fix 2: Clean Boot Windows

To ensure there’s no conflicting software (such as anti-virus software), clean boot Windows.

Clean booting Windows will strip down the startup programs and start Windows with minimal drivers. This is how you can clean boot Windows:

  • First, open the Run accessory with the Windows key + R hotkey.
  • Enter ‘MSConfig’ in Run and click OK to open the System Information window shown directly below.
  • Select the Selective startup items option on the General tab.
  • Deselect the Load startup items checkbox.
  • Select both the Load system services and Use original boot configuration options.
  • Select the service tab shown directly below.
  • Then click the Hide all Microsoft services checkbox.
  • Press the Disable all button.
  • Click the Apply>OK buttons to confirm the newly selected settings.
  • Press the Restart button on the System Configuration dialog box that opens.
  • Then delete, rename, or extract the required folder or file after the clean booting Windows. After that, you can restore Windows to the standard startup configuration via the System Configuration window.


The fixes mentioned above will help you to resolve error 0x80004005. Follow them carefully.

Leave a Comment

Your email address will not be published.